Kulim’s Rising Star: 14-Year-Old Yaadana Becomes Only Malaysian Indian Selected for Zee Tamil Audition

by Shangkari
December 11, 2025
91
SHARES
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terSend

In a small town in Kedah, a young Malaysian girl with a big voice is quietly making history. Fourteen-year-old Yaadana, a gifted singer from Kulim, has become the only Indian participant from both Malaysia and Singapore selected for the prestigious Zee Tamil Junior audits, a platform that has launched some of South Asia’s brightest young musical talents.

For many Malaysian Indian families, Zee Tamil Junior is a dream stage, a place where young voices from around the world hope to be heard. This year, one of those voices belongs to a soft-spoken but extraordinarily determined girl from Kulim, whose journey proves that geography cannot limit talent.

A Voice That Captured Hearts

Representing Malaysia, Yaadana delivered a soulful rendition of ‘Adiye Adiye’ from Kadal (2012) during her audition. What followed was a moment that every aspiring singer dreams of, genuine appreciation from industry’s most respected names, such as Saindhavi, Srinivas, and Shweta Mohan.

The judges praised her tone, emotional depth, and natural poise, rare qualities for someone her age. For a 14-year-old to hold her own before such seasoned musicians speaks volumes about her raw ability and fearless passion.

A Breakthrough Beyond Borders

In being selected, Yaadana joins a long-standing legacy of Indian performers across the globe, yet her achievement stands out uniquely. She is no only one of the youngest Malaysians to step onto an international Tamil music platform, but also a shining example of how local talent can rise onto global stages with the right support.

At a time when representation matters more than ever, her success places Malaysia proudly on the international arts map, proving that young Malaysian Indians can shine just as brightly as their peers anywhere else in the world.

A Moment for Malaysians to Rally Behind

As Yaadana steps into the next phase of Zee Tamil Junior, she carries not just her own dreams, but the hopes of an entire community that has watched her grow. This is a moment for Malaysians, especially Malaysian Indians, to stand behind her with the same love and support given to other international contestants. Her journey reminds us that talent thrives when a community believes in it.

In many ways, Yaadana represents a new generation of Malaysian youth, confident, creative, and unafraid to dream beyond borders. Her accomplishment is already inspiring younger children who now see someone like themselves on an international stage.

From Kulim to the global spotlight, her story is a testament to dedication, courage, and the power of believing in one’s own voice. As she continues her journey in Zee Tamil Junior, one message rings clear: Malaysia has a new rising star, and her name is Yaadana.
